A four bedroom Grade II Listed barn conversion, located in an idyllic rural setting just outside of Eynsham.

The ground floor features a spacious open-plan reception area with exposed beams, incorporating an entrance hall, a sitting room with a log burner. This level also includes a charming country-style kitchen with a larder and generous dining space, a utility room, a shower room, and one double bedroom.
Upstairs, a large galleried landing doubles as an excellent study or work-from-home space. The accommodation includes a primary bedroom with an adjacent bathroom featuring a roll-top bath and separate double shower, two further double bedrooms, and a family bathroom.
Approached via a private lane, the property benefits from driveway parking for multiple vehicles and an expansive landscaped garden featuring a picturesque pond.

SITUATION
The property forms part of a complex of converted barns and is surrounded by open countryside, with access to countryside walks just a few moments away including a scenic walk to the local pubs in Church Hanborough and Long Hanborough. The nearby village of Eynsham is situated close by and is almost equidistant between the market town of Witney and the city of Oxford. It has an excellent range of local amenities including primary and secondary schools, doctors surgery, chemist, two supermarkets, local butcher and baker, a greengrocer, Post Office, library, village hall, three churches and a number of public houses and restaurants. The property is ideally situated to serve the commuter, with both Long Hanborough and Oxford Parkway stations within close proximity.
